Acerca de esta escucha
Life can be hard when everyone around you expects you to be something you’re not. Whether you’re not good at it or simply don’t like it, we all want to follow our own dreams, not someone else’s.
This is exactly what happened to Barney. He was a horse born so that people could achieve their dreams, but he had other plans. From home to home and trainer to trainer, it seems he will never be anything but a disappointment. However, if he can stay true to his heart, he just might find the perfect family.
Nobody's Champion follows the life of a young quarter horse as he makes his own path in life. Not content to accept the dreams of others, he tries to show everyone that stepping outside the box can be fun. Getting people to listen to him isn't always easy, but he'll keep trying until someone finally hears him!

The Man Who Listens to Horses
- De: Monty Roberts
- Narrado por: Ed Sala
- Duración: 11 h y 16 m
- Versión completa
-
General
-
Narración:
-
Historia
Monty Roberts' father, a traditional horse trainer, had taught his son to dominate a horse in order to "break" it. But when he was 13, Monty made a discovery that changed his life. As he watched a mare tame a rebellious colt, Monty saw that she was speaking to it through eye and body movements. Astonished, Monty realized that he could train horses by using their language, speaking to them in ways that would form trust and understanding. Developing techniques based on what he learned from the horses around him, Monty embarked on a remarkable career - one that would bring him international fame as the real Horse Whisperer.

A Girl and Five Brave Horses
- De: Sonora Carver
- Narrado por: Andrea Giordani
- Duración: 6 h y 13 m
- Versión completa
-
General
-
Narración:
-
Historia
Sonora Carver (1904-2003) was a circus entertainer and one of the first female horse divers. In the arresting autobiography A Girl and Five Brave Horses, Sonora tells her life story. Her sensational act was mounting a running horse as it reached the top of a 40-foot or 60-foot tower and sailing down on its back as it plunged into an 11-foot pool of water below. In 1931, she was blinded due to hitting the water off balance with open eyes while diving her horse. After the accident, she continued to dive horses until 1942.

American Pharoah
- The Untold Story of the Triple Crown Winner's Legendary Rise
- De: Joe Drape
- Narrado por: Aaron Abano
- Duración: 8 h y 36 m
- Versión completa
-
General
-
Narración:
-
Historia
History was made at the 2015 Belmont Stakes when American Pharoah won the Triple Crown, the first since Affirmed in 1978. As magnificent as the champion is, the team behind him has been all too human while on the road to immortality. Written by an award-winning New York Times sportswriter, American Pharoah is the definitive account not only of how the ethereal colt won the Kentucky Derby, Preakness, and Belmont Stakes, but how he changed lives. Through extensive interviews, Drape explores the making of an exceptional racehorse, chronicling key events en route to history.
